**Changelog — FurrowLink Gateway v2.8**

Defaults changed for telemetry upload cadence on the FurrowLink gateway. After reviewing battery drain reports from the Halmer Valley pilot, we moved from 30-second to 120-second upload intervals when equipment is idle, keeping the 10-second interval while implements are engaged. Retry backoff now caps at five minutes instead of one. Units ship with the new defaults starting this build; fielded units pick them up on next check-in. The current shipped configuration is as follows.

deployment values, yadug-bawif:
[framir]
team = pelox
access_code = ac_a38ab2
owner = tamion.julael
host = framir.tolvaqlabs.test
port = 11211
peer = tammir.zemvargrid.local
salt = 2215ef03
pin = 1541

## Build Provenance: Config Hot-Reload (Skylark Gateway)

Skylark Gateway reloads its routing configuration without restart whenever the watcher detects a change on the config volume. For on-call purposes, note that a hot-reload does **not** produce a new build artifact — the binary stays the same while the effective config hash changes. Always record both before escalating. The reload event log in the Marmot dashboard shows the config hash history per pod. The currently deployed build is identified by the token that follows.

session token of tajef-bageg = htk21_5d90d574934f3ccae6437

Subject: Handover — Coldpath release signing

Hi,

Before you review the Coldpath changes, note that our serverless handlers now pre-warm via the Fennick scheduler, cutting cold starts roughly in half. The warm-pool config ships with each release bundle, so every deploy must be signed or the scheduler rejects it. Please verify signatures against the key below.

signing key of baduf-kafog = bky6_Azw6Lf

[ ] Audio-guide rollout — Gallerim app v4.2. Before you flip the update live for the Whitmore Hall exhibits, double-check that offline tour packs still download on older tablets; that bit us last time. If a visitor reports silent playback, have them force-close and relaunch before escalating. When logging any ticket about this release, quote the build token that appears directly under this checklist item.

pipeline stamp: htk4_ae36